Please check out our stories as I update you on the project!!

As our Coffee, Chill & Spill peer support sessions come to an end, we want to take a moment to acknowledge the space we’ve created together — one of honesty, understanding, and connection. These sessions have offered a chance to pause, share, and simply be, without judgment. Whether you came every week or just once, your presence made a difference. While this chapter is closing I hope the conversations, connections, and calm moments you found with us continue to support you in the days ahead. Thank you for being part of it of CC&S peer support and please keep using the resources over the next 4 months ❤️

Welcome

My name is Vik and I have created coffee, chill and spill as a resource for new mums to reach out to. After the birth of my second baby, I experienced severe anxiety; I found myself in a place I never thought I would be in and it was really scary and at times lonely. I really wanted to create a sense of community for new mums; A safe place to talk, or just to sit and have a little bit of focus on them. We have so many wonderful baby groups in the area (Stockport), but there is very little in the way of support for mums. We go through such a massive transition having a baby, and the main focus is on prenatal and birth care. However, recovery from birth and getting to grips with being a mummy were way harder than pregnancy for me. I have created this page, a closed Facebook group and also a Maternal well being group at Heaton Norris Community centre, that will run weekly. It will be open to mums who are feeling a little lost, isolated or just overwhelmed. A mother’s wellbeing is just as important as the baby’s wellbeing and I wanted to provide somewhere that supports that. Please do not hesitate to get in touch.

Vik x
